can you make iDVD projects longer than 60 minutes? i thought this limitation was being removed in iDVD 3???
I just got it over the weekend. iDVD 3 is an incredible piece of software, but this horrible fact still makes this program almost useless to me.
(edit)
I just noticed on Apple's site it says this "You can put up to 90 minutes of movies and thousands of digital stills on each DVD disc." I can not make iDVD make a project over 60 minutes. What's up? This is still a jip. A DVD can hold 2 hours of video. You are short changing us Apple. Where are my other 30 minutes dammit!!!

You should be able to. You were able to in iDVD2 as well. It warns you that going over 60 mins will increase compression (decrease video quality).
